Purchase contract (completely
filled in)
-
Copy of earnest money check (both
front and back)
-
Photocopies of canceled checks
for the past 12 months of mortgage payments (copy both the
front and back of each check)
-
Information on your last two years' rental history,
including rental addresses and landlord's phone numbers
-
Employment history for the past two years, including name, address, and phone number of each employer, as well as paycheck stubs for each person named on the mortgage for the past 30 days
-
If a business owner, contractor, or paid through commission or
receiving substantial bonuses, provide all related information
concerning your earnings for the past two years (including all
schedules and attachments to your tax returns); business
owners will also need to provide a year-to-date profit and
loss statement
-
Tax returns (including attached W-2 and/or 1099 forms) for
each person named on the mortgage for the last 2 years
-
Proof of any other income not included above (interest, dividends, IRAs,
etc.)
-
Banking information, including account number, balance,
and name on account for all checking, savings, and brokerage
accounts, as well as full bank statements for at least the
past 90 days on all accounts
-
Information on all of the bills you pay monthly (ie credit
cards, loans, child support or alimony, etc. but not including
utilities), including who the payments are owed to, account number, balance
owed, and amount of monthly payment
-
Information on any other real estate owned by any
borrower, to include property address, lease information, loan
information, and tax information
-
Information relating to any substantial assets, especially
boats, recreational vehicles, and other valuable vehicles,
such as purchase date and original cost, year/make/model,
amount owed (if any), current value estimates
-
Photo identification (usually a driver's license) for Borrower and
any/all Co-borrowers (who must all appear in person).
Sometimes a social security card is requested as well
*You should also be prepared to pay for a current credit
report and associated appraisal fees if you have not already
paid your mortgage lender for these expenses.
Depending on lender and your particular situation, additional documentation
(if applicable) may be required, such as:
- Divorce decree
- Gift letter (accompanied by front and back copy of gift
check and sometimes a copy of givers bank statement)
- Details and documentation of bankruptcy
- Documentation relating to alien status
- Certificate of eligibility and DD214 (VA loans)
- Off-Base Housing Authorization (active duty military only)
